hi ive got an 88 4runner v6 5speed and need to replace the rear end some dumb ass hit me and bent it. curious whether or not a 88 pickup rear end sould bolt up with no problems

Yes it will. Any 84-95 4wd truck or 4Runner (up to '02' 4Runner) rear end will work.

Just make sure the ring and pinion is the same ratio (count the teeth)

so if the 4 banger has the smaller third member and the v6 has the bigger third member will it make a difference

Generally speaking, no. They are interchangeable. The V6 third has larger bearings and pinion gear, and a little different carrier. You would never know the difference if I had not told you.
